Exegesis

The construct numeral šibʿat yamim {שִׁבְעַ֣ת יָמִ֗ם | šibʿat yā·mim} ‘seven days’ marks duration.

In context1 Samuel 13:8

He waited seven days for the appointed time Samuel had set, but Samuel did not come to Gilgal , and the people scattered from him.
